Josiah Hawes 1777–1851 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 22 February 1777

Birth Location: Warren, Litchfield County, Connecticut, USA

Death Date: 26 June 1851

Death Location: Sidney, Delaware County, New York, USA

Father: Isaac Hawes

Mother: Anna Whitlock

Spouse(s):

Children(s):

Josiah Hawes was born in 1777 in Warren, Litchfield County, Connecticut, USA, the child of Isaac Hawes And Anna Whitlock. Josiah Hawes passed away in 1851 in Sidney, Delaware County, New York, USA.
